Файл: templates/web_default/js/shcms_code.js
Строк: 154
<?php
(function($) {
$(function() {
$('select').selectbox();
$('#add').click(function(e) {
$(this).parents('div.section').append('<br /><br /><select><option>-- Выберите --</option><option>Пункт 1</option><option>Пункт 2</option><option>Пункт 3</option><option>Пункт 4</option><option>Пункт 5</option></select>');
$('select').selectbox();
e.preventDefault();
})
$('#add2').click(function(e) {
var options = '';
for (i = 1; i <= 5; i++) {
options += '<option>Option ' + i + '</option>';
}
$(this).parents('div.section').find('select').each(function() {
$(this).append(options);
})
$('select').trigger('refresh');
e.preventDefault();
})
$('#che').click(function(e) {
$(this).parents('div.section').find('option:nth-child(5)').attr('selected', true);
$('select').trigger('refresh');
e.preventDefault();
})
})
})(jQuery)
$(document).ready(function() {
$('#password').keyup(function(){
$('#result').html(checkStrength($('#password').val()))
})
function checkStrength(password){
//initial strength
var strength = 0
//if the password length is less than 6, return message.
if (password.length < 6) {
$('#result').removeClass()
$('#result').addClass('short')
return 'Cлишком короткий'
}
//length is ok, lets continue.
//if length is 8 characters or more, increase strength value
if (password.length > 7) strength += 1
//if password contains both lower and uppercase characters, increase strength value
if (password.match(/([a-z].*[A-Z])|([A-Z].*[a-z])/)) strength += 1
//if it has numbers and characters, increase strength value
if (password.match(/([a-zA-Z])/) && password.match(/([0-9])/)) strength += 1
//if it has one special character, increase strength value
if (password.match(/([!,%,&,@,#,$,^,*,?,_,~])/)) strength += 1
//if it has two special characters, increase strength value
if (password.match(/(.*[!,%,&,@,#,$,^,*,?,_,~].*[!,%,&,@,#,$,^,*,?,_,~])/)) strength += 1
//now we have calculated strength value, we can return messages
//if value is less than 2
if (strength < 2 ) {
$('#result').removeClass()
$('#result').addClass('weak')
return 'Легкий'
} else if (strength == 2 ) {
$('#result').removeClass()
$('#result').addClass('good')
return 'Хороший'
} else {
$('#result').removeClass()
$('#result').addClass('strong')
return 'Тяжелый'
}
}
});
/*JQUERY UI PARAM VAR*/
$(function() {
$( "#dialog" ).dialog({
autoOpen: false,
width: 270,
});
$( "#opener" ).click(function() {
$( "#dialog" ).dialog( "open" );
});
});
$(function() {
$("#datepicker").datepicker($.datepicker.regional["ru"],{dateFormat:'dd.mm.yy'});
$("#datepicker2").datepicker($.datepicker.regional["ru"],{dateFormat:'dd.mm.yy'});
});
(function($) {
$(function() {
$('input, select').styler();
});
});
$(document).ready(function() {
var wbbOpt = {
lang: "ru"
}
$('#editor').wysibb({
smileList:
[
{title:CURLANG.sm1, img: '<img src="/engine/template/smilies/2.gif" class="sm">', bbcode:":)"},
{title:CURLANG.sm8, img: '<img src="/engine/template/smilies/3.gif" class="sm">', bbcode:":("},
{title:CURLANG.sm1, img: '<img src="/engine/template/smilies/1.gif" class="sm">', bbcode:":D"},
{title:CURLANG.sm3, img: '<img src="/engine/template/smilies/6.gif" class="sm">', bbcode:":so:"},
{title:CURLANG.sm4, img: '<img src="/engine/template/smilies/11.gif" class="sm">', bbcode:":P"},
{title:CURLANG.sm5, img: '<img src="/engine/template/smilies/9.gif" class="sm">', bbcode:":ir:"},
{title:CURLANG.sm6, img: '<img src="/engine/template/smilies/12.gif" class="sm">', bbcode:":cry:"},
{title:CURLANG.sm7, img: '<img src="/engine/template/smilies/13.gif" class="sm">', bbcode:":rage:"},
{title:CURLANG.sm9, img: '<img src="/engine/template/smilies/23.gif" class="sm">', bbcode:":think:"},
{title:CURLANG.sm10, img: '<img src="/engine/template/smilies/14.gif" class="sm">', bbcode:":B"},
{title:CURLANG.sm11, img: '<img src="/engine/template/smilies/25.gif" class="sm">', bbcode:":roul:"},
{title:CURLANG.sm12, img: '<img src="/engine/template/smilies/27.gif" class="sm">', bbcode:":o"},
{title:CURLANG.sm13, img: '<img src="/engine/template/smilies/31.gif" class="sm">', bbcode:":appl:"},
{title:CURLANG.sm14, img: '<img src="/engine/template/smilies/32.gif" class="sm">', bbcode:":idnk:"},
{title:CURLANG.sm15, img: '<img src="/engine/template/smilies/45.gif" class="sm">', bbcode:":E"},
{title:CURLANG.sm16, img: '<img src="/engine/template/smilies/37.gif" class="sm">', bbcode:":alc:"}
]
});
});
?>